HDF5 up to 1.14.3 H5Omtime.c H5O__mtime_new_encode heap-based overflow

Summary
A vulnerability identified as critical has been detected in HDF5 up to 1.14.3. Affected is the function H5O__mtime_new_encode of the file H5Omtime.c. This manipulation causes heap-based overflow.
This vulnerability appears as CVE-2024-33874. There is no available exploit.
Details
A vulnerability has been found in HDF5 up to 1.14.3 and classified as critical. Affected by this vulnerability is the function H5O__mtime_new_encode of the file H5Omtime.c. The manipulation with an unknown input leads to a heap-based overflow vulnerability. The CWE definition for the vulnerability is CWE-122. A heap overflow condition is a buffer overflow, where the buffer that can be overwritten is allocated in the heap portion of memory, generally meaning that the buffer was allocated using a routine such as malloc(). As an impact it is known to affect confidentiality, integrity, and availability.
The advisory is shared at hdfgroup.org. This vulnerability is known as CVE-2024-33874 since 04/27/2024. The exploitation appears to be easy. Technical details are known, but no exploit is available.
The vulnerability scanner Nessus provides a plugin with the ID 215945 (Azure Linux 3.0 Security Update: hdf5 (CVE-2024-33874)), which helps to determine the existence of the flaw in a target environment.
There is no information about possible countermeasures known. It may be suggested to replace the affected object with an alternative product.
